In the modern Android ecosystem, the ability to manage multiple accounts, run legacy applications, and utilize powerful tools without rooting your device has become increasingly valuable. While manufacturers and app developers are rapidly moving toward 64-bit-only environments, millions of users still rely on older 32-bit applications and games. This creates a compatibility challenge: how can you run a 32-bit game on a modern 64-bit Android system, clone apps for multiple accounts, and still use advanced tools like GameGuardian—all without voiding your warranty or compromising device security?

Rooting a phone unlocks full administrative control but voids warranties, disables banking apps, and introduces severe security risks. Virtual spaces provide a workaround by mimicking root environments internally. How No-Root Virtual Spaces Work

A virtual space acts as an isolated sandbox operating system inside your actual phone.
